Fees & policies

Mandatory fees

You'll be asked to pay the following charges by the property at check-in or check-out. Fees may include applicable taxes:
  • A tax is imposed by the city: EUR 1.50 per person, per night, up to 7 nights. This tax does not apply to children under 14 years of age.

Optional extras

  • Housekeeping is offered for an extra charge

Children & extra beds

  • Cribs/infant beds are available for EUR 6.0 per stay
  • All guests, including children, must be present at check-in and show their government-issued photo ID card or passport

Pets

  • Service animals exempt from fees
  • Pets are allowed for an extra charge of EUR 30 per accommodation, per stay

Pool, spa, & gym (if applicable)

  • The seasonal pool is open from May 31 to September 30

Policies

This property does not have elevators.
Host has not indicated whether there is a carbon monoxide detector on the property; consider bringing a portable detector with you on the trip.
Host has not indicated whether there is a smoke detector on the property.
This property accepts credit cards and cash.
Credit cards accepted: Visa, Mastercard
Cash transactions at this property cannot exceed EUR 5000, due to national regulations. For further details, please contact the property using information in the booking confirmation.

4/10 Fair

Room was fine- ac was a bit loud, beds were clean, bathroom had one tiny bottle of 2 in 1 shampoo/body wash and 1 roll of toilet paper (they only supply enough toilet paper for one day and then you have to buy more in the market). The property itself had a pool (nice for lounging, not so much for swimming), a market, and restaurant (both overpriced). There’s a shuttle to Florence but it only runs from 9:30-7 so you can’t get breakfast or dinner in the city (hence the overpriced restaurant and market). Overall the property has everything you need, but just expect to pay for it.
Kyla, 5-night trip

4/10 Fair

The room is nice, price is good. But the swimming pool hours are not convenient as they open only from 11-7p so you cant check out City of Florence much if you want to use their pool. The room is nice but the view is not as good as all we see are the back of the other Bungalows. No internet in the room ( we stay at the new Bungalow areas). Dusty area in front of the cabin as they layer with small rocks. Its far from the bus stop ( about 11-13mins) and dangerous to walk to the bus stop as there is no side walk. It costs about 40$ for 1 way taxi to Florence center.
Jacob, 2-night trip
